Thirteen members of an armed group that carried out deadly attacks on Tajikistan's police force were killed in a security operation, the interior ministry said Saturday.

The operation by both the army and police follows attacks Friday, in which eight policemen and nine militants were killed, which the government says were orchestrated by former deputy defence minister Abduhalim Nazarzoda.

"At this time, 32 members of Nazarzoda's criminal group have been detained, 13 of whom have been eliminated," the ministry said in a statement.
